Output 50cfb8264abb89d86b736059bc4c612e7136aa725d9597d9cccc1184051983f1:14

value
3492300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bccfb9e10a70ffc591ccdc7c1dd6f8f0ca87995 OP_EQUALVERIFY OP_CHECKSIG
address
1M3CYUKmLcrApoXuzgZKVufE8MpijFQVze
transaction
50cfb8264abb89d86b736059bc4c612e7136aa725d9597d9cccc1184051983f1
spent
true